About Combe

Combe is a small village located in Herefordshire, England, within the LD8 postcode area. It is surrounded by the rolling hills and countryside typical of this part of the country. The village features a few residential homes and local farms, reflecting the rural character of the region.

The area is primarily agricultural, with fields and pastures that contribute to the local economy. Combe is situated not far from larger towns, making it accessible for those seeking a quieter lifestyle while still being close to essential amenities. The village offers a glimpse into everyday life in the English countryside, with its simple charm and natural surroundings.

Household Income in Combe ONS 2023

The average total household income in Combe is approximately £41,791 a year before tax, 24%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£31,235.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Combe ONS 2025

There are approximately 346 active businesses based in Combe, around 80 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 94%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 2 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Combe

Of the 1,999 households in and around Combe, 72% are owned, 10% are socially rented and 18%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
